Market Overview
The cfRNA analysis market encompasses technologies and products used to isolate, detect, and quantify extracellular RNA molecules from liquid samples such as blood, plasma, and serum. Unlike traditional cell-based RNA analysis, cfRNA offers a non-invasive window into disease states and biological processes without requiring tissue biopsies. The market spans instrumentation, reagent kits, consumables, and bioinformatics software serving research laboratories, clinical diagnostics laboratories, and pharmaceutical development programs.
- •Applications span oncology, prenatal testing, infectious disease, and organ transplant monitoring
- •cfRNA's relative stability in circulation makes it valuable for longitudinal disease tracking and treatment response assessment
Growth Drivers
Market expansion is primarily fueled by the growing preference for liquid biopsy approaches in precision medicine and oncology care. Cancer incidence rates continue to rise globally, creating substantial demand for minimally invasive diagnostic tools capable of detecting tumor-derived RNA signatures. Additionally, pharmaceutical companies increasingly rely on cfRNA for companion diagnostic development and pharmacodynamic biomarker studies, while ongoing technological improvements have reduced assay costs and improved analytical sensitivity.
- •Rising global cancer burden and demand for minimally invasive early detection methods
- •Growing pharmaceutical investment in biomarker-driven drug development and personalized therapies
- •Advancements in next-generation sequencing and PCR platforms improving sensitivity and throughput
Segmentation and Regional Analysis
The market is segmented by product type into instruments, reagents and kits, consumables, and software and bioinformatics tools, with reagents and kits representing the largest revenue segment due to their recurring consumption requirements. By application, oncology diagnostics leads adoption, though infectious disease testing and prenatal screening segments are expanding rapidly. Geographically, North America holds the largest market share supported by advanced healthcare infrastructure and substantial research funding, while the Asia-Pacific region is emerging as the fastest-growing market.
- •Reagents and kits segment drives repeat revenue due to assay consumable requirements across high-volume testing
- •North America leads adoption with strong R&D spending and favorable regulatory pathways
- •Asia-Pacific growth is accelerated by expanding healthcare access, rising disease prevalence, and increased diagnostic investment
Trends and Outlook
What are the recent trends and outlook?
The cfRNA analysis market is positioned for sustained growth through the coming decade, driven by the convergence of liquid biopsy adoption, artificial intelligence applications in biomarker discovery, and increasing clinical validation of cfRNA assays. Regulatory agencies are gradually establishing clearer frameworks for cfRNA-based diagnostic approvals, which will facilitate broader clinical adoption. The integration of multi-omics approaches combining cfRNA with cell-free DNA, proteins, and methylation markers is expected to create new market opportunities and enhance diagnostic accuracy across disease areas.
- •AI and machine learning are accelerating the identification of novel cfRNA biomarkers from large-scale patient cohorts
- •Growing clinical validation studies are supporting regulatory submissions for cfRNA-based companion diagnostics
- •Multi-modal liquid biopsy panels incorporating cfRNA alongside other biomarker classes represent the next evolution in market offerings
